The exchange of new light(ish) bosons coupled to electrons and nucleons leads to extra forces and corresponding potentials between particles and even macroscopic bodies. The high accuracy achievable in measurements on atoms and ions provides a powerful laboratory to test these forces at atomic and smaller distances.
